The transition to renewable energy sources in the electricity sector is not just reshaping how we power our homes but also how we pay for that power. What are the key questions surrounding this shift in electricity pricing structures?

One important question is how the variability of renewable energy sources impacts pricing and reliability. While solar and wind energy have become more predictable and consistent, there are still challenges associated with integrating these intermittent sources into the grid effectively.

Another crucial aspect is the role of energy storage in stabilizing pricing. How do batteries and other storage solutions influence the way renewable energy is priced? Energy storage technologies play a vital role in capturing excess energy from renewable sources and releasing it when demand is high, helping to balance supply and demand and mitigate price spikes.

Furthermore, what are the key advantages and disadvantages of this new pricing system? One significant advantage is the potential for consumers to save money by capitalizing on lower prices during peak renewable energy generation times. However, a potential downside is the need for flexible pricing structures and smart grid technologies to accommodate the variability of renewable sources.
